My Next Life as a Villainess: All Routes Lead to Doom! - Season 2

Season 2

Episodes

I Avoided My Doom Flags, So I Got Carried Away at the Cultural Festival…
Catarina Claes, the daughter of a duke, successfully avoided all of her doom flags and is now enjoying her school life. One day, she learns that the school festival is coming up, and she's psyched to experience it. Geordo and the other student council members are swamped with festival preparations, so Catarina is left on her own to wonder what kinds of foods she'll find at the event.

I Turned Into a Villainess…
One of the actors in the play being put on by the student council is injured, and the search is on for an emergency stand-in. As the opening of the curtain draws nearer and nearer, Catarina ends up agreeing to fill the role at Sophia's request. She's given a script with a story that sounds very familiar, and then her time comes to take the stage.

I Was Captured…
Catarina is kidnapped by someone while on her way to the ball, but after awakening in an unfamiliar room, she struggles to fully grasp her situation and doesn't seem to realize she's been kidnapped. Even when the kidnapper shows up to see her in person and she asks why she was kidnapped, her questions are easily dodged. Meanwhile, Geordo receives a letter from the kidnapper and immediately begins an investigation to find and rescue Catarina.

I Had a Friendly Tea Time With an Attractive Butler…
The one behind the kidnapping of Catarina Claes turns out to be someone that nobody expected. Catarina is shocked to learn the true reason why he kidnapped her, but he's so moved by her cheerful demeanor that he begins to tell her more and more about himself. As he does, Catarina proposes an idea...

Love for the Younger Brothers Poured Forth…
The day after the resolution of Catarina Claes's kidnapping, the first prince, Jeffrey Stuart, passionately speaks of his love for his younger brothers to his fiancée, Susanna Randall. At the same time, Geordo and Alan are in the student council office, reminiscing about their childhood days with their older brothers.

I Had a Summer Adventure…
Catarina is overwhelmed by Geordo's suddenly passionate advances. Since she had no romantic experience in her previous life, either, she has no idea what to do. When she receives an invitation to stay at the royal palace villa, she's still unable to sort out her feelings, and upon arriving there, she learns that the nearby forest is rumored to be haunted by a ghost.

My Wish Was Granted…
Raphael Wolt, an employee at the Department of Magic, welcomes Catarina and her friends for a tour of the facility. Lana leads them in an experiment on a magic tool she recently acquired from an antiquarian: a so-called "wish-granting doll house." The moment she sees the old, run-down doll house, Catarina can't help opening the tightly shut front door...

I Had an Arranged Marriage Meeting…
Nicol makes the decision to go through with an arranged marriage. Although he meets many prospective partners, all he can think about while talking to them is Catarina, so none of them get past the first meeting. Then, one day, his sister Sophia recommends that he read some romance novels for a change of pace.

Keith Disappeared… Part 1
Catarina is feeling thrown off by her sudden awareness of Geordo, so when she's back at home during a break from school, she spends her time working her fields for a change of pace. When she's done, she heads to Keith's room to show him the vegetables she's grown... but Keith isn't there, and instead she finds a letter in his room saying that he's running away.

Keith Disappeared… Part 2
Catarina and a few of her friends set out on a journey to find Keith, assisted by Larna. Catarina still believes Keith left because of her. She tries her hardest to find some sort of clue in the first town they stop in, but there's no useful information to be found. In the midst of all this, the captured Keith worries about the sister he left behind.

Keith Disappeared… Part 3
Upon learning that Keith was kidnapped, Catarina heads to the mansion that Alexander indicated to save him. The group enters the mansion even as Maria detects powerful dark magic there. After slipping past the many guards, they arrive at a hidden room, where they find Keith lying on the floor with his hands and feet bound.

My Graduation Ceremony Happened…
Catarina Claes is finally graduating from the Magic Academy. Catarina reflects on the past two years as she talks with all of her precious friends and attends a graduation party at the castle. There, they all speak of their feelings for her, starting with Geordo.

The Ministry of Time
The Ministry of Time, a newly established government department, is gathering ‘expats' from across history in an experiment to test the viability of time-travel. Commander Graham Gore (an officer on Sir John Franklin's doomed 1845 Arctic expedition) is one such figure rescued from certain death – alongside an army captain from the fields of the Somme, a plague victim from the 1600s, a widow from revolutionary France, and a soldier from the seventeenth century.
The expats are placed with 21st century liaisons, known as 'bridges', in unlikely flatshares. Gore has to learn about contemporary life from scratch: from air travel to industrial warfare, from feminism to Spotify, from cinema to indoor plumbing; and he must negotiate cohabiting with the ambitious modern woman who works as his bridge. After an awkward beginning, the pair start to find pleasure and comfort in each other's company, developing a relationship that is simultaneously tender, intense and profoundly unprofessional; and the expats, adrift in a new era, form friendships that ground and support them in the lonely 21st century, where they have outlived everyone they ever knew and loved.
When a deeper conspiracy at the Ministry begins to reveal itself, the bridge must reckon with what she does next. Will she save or sacrifice the exiled misfits she has come to care for so deeply?
